 Ana L. Reyes’ story is one of unwavering faith, resilience, and service. Born in San Juan, Puerto Rico, Ana has dedicated her life to her family, community, and ministry. A devoted wife, mother, and grandmother, she has also spent 20 years shaping young minds as a teacher. Alongside her husband, Rev. Marc Reyes, she has led Good Shepherd Ministries Church in West Haven, CT, for nearly two decades. In 2017, Ana was diagnosed with cancer, and three years later, she became an amputee. But her faith never wavered.
